Pardon me if you had already seen this. One of my husband's favorite breakfast is the so called steakless steak. It is composed of fried potatoes and onions is added then a tablespoon of soy sauce before turning off the stove. It goes well with bread and vegetable salad just like eating real steak. I think it is healthy because there is no meat.
